Random Operator Theory provides a comprehensive discussion of the random norm of random bounded linear operators, also providing important random norms as random norms of differentiation operators and integral operators. After providing the basic definition of random norm of random bounded linear operators, the book then delves into the study of random operator theory, with final sections discussing the concept of random Banach algebras and its applications.

  • Explores random differentiation and random integral equations
  • Delves into the study of random operator theory
  • Discusses the concept of random Banach algebras and its applications
Industry Reviews
"...provides a great opportunity for mathematicians and research scholars to get acquainted with the theory of random normed spaces, random norm of random bounded linear operators, random Banach algebras and the basic facts in this field." --Zentralblatt MATH
